In the electrical equipment in the substation, the capacity of the equipment is greatly affected by the capacity of the equipment, which directly affects the stable operation of the power system. Based on the above background, this paper studies and designs an on-line monitoring system for capacitive equipment in substation, and is expected to provide a powerful guarantee for the stable and reliable operation of power system.Firstly the topic research background and research significance are described, the research status of wireless sensor network are analyzed. Then related research topics are introduced, such as data sampling theory, sampling theorem, quantization and quantization error of basic knowledge, signal sampling technology, wireless sensor network technology, wireless data transmission technology and wireless network technology. The overall structure of an on-line monitoring system for capacitive equipment is constructed, and the data acquisition circuit of high accuracy sensor and USB interface circuit are introduced in detail; the high precision current sensor is described and optimized, and the hardware control of wireless sensor network node is introduced. Finally, the wireless network cards used in the system are discussed. In the design of sensor network software,First of all, the system software is designed, and those software for the USB driver and the wireless network card driver are developed, and then the wireless communication program and the client program and server side program are done by using the current popular SOCKET communication technology. At the end, tthe signal acquisition capability of the on-line monitoring system is verified by the analysis of the standard signal source.
